What is Tirzepatide? A Breakthrough in GLP-1 and GIP Agonism
Tirzepatide is a unique medication because it acts as a dual agonist, meaning it activates two different types of receptors in the body: gl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1) receptors and glucose-dependent insulinotropic polypeptide (GIP) receptors. These are both natural hormones (incretins) produced by your gut in response to eating, playing crucial roles in regulating blood sugar and appetite.
When you eat, GLP-1 and GIP are released, signaling to the pancreas to produce more insulin, which helps lower blood sugar. They also tell the liver to reduce its glucose production. Beyond blood sugar regulation, these incretins influence satiety and gastric emptying. Tirzepatide mimics the action of both these natural hormones, leading to a cascade of beneficial effects for metabolic health and weight loss.
The Mechanisms Behind Its Effectiveness
The dual agonism of tirzepatide allows it to work through several pathways to support weight loss and improve metabolic markers:
Regulating Blood Sugar Levels
For individuals with type 2 diabetes, tirzepatide significantly improves glycemic control. It enhances insulin secretion when blood sugar levels are high, making the body more efficient at using glucose. Simultaneously, it reduces glucagon secretion, a hormone that raises blood sugar, and slows down gastric emptying. This combined action helps to stabilize blood sugar, preventing spikes after meals and maintaining more consistent levels throughout the day. Reducing Appetite and Enhancing Satiety
One of the most impactful ways tirzepatide contributes to weight loss is by influencing appetite. By slowing gastric emptying, food stays in the stomach longer, promoting a feeling of fullness. Additionally, tirzepatide interacts with brain regions that control appetite and reward, leading to reduced food intake and decreased cravings. This helps individuals adhere to a calorie-reduced diet more easily, without the constant struggle against hunger that often derails weight loss efforts. Common Side Effects of Tirzepatide and How to Manage Them
Understanding the potential side effects is a crucial part of answering the question, “is it safe to take tirzepatide?” Most individuals experience mild to moderate side effects, primarily gastrointestinal, especially when starting the medication or increasing the dose. These often diminish over time as the body adjusts.
Gastrointestinal Concerns
The most frequently reported side effects of tirzepatide are related to the digestive system. These include:
- Nausea and Vomiting: Many individuals report feeling nauseous, particularly after their weekly injection.
- Diarrhea or Constipation: Changes in bowel habits are common, with some experiencing loose stools and others struggling with constipation.
- Abdominal Pain and Upset Stomach: Discomfort, pain, or a general feeling of indigestion in the stomach area can occur.
- Reduced Appetite: While often a desired effect for weight loss, it can sometimes be more pronounced than comfortable.
- Belching and Heartburn: Increased gas and reflux symptoms are also reported.
Strategies for Managing Common Side Effects:
Our comprehensive programs include unlimited support, where healthcare providers can offer guidance on managing these effects. Here are some general strategies:
- Start Low, Go Slow: Dosing is typically increased gradually, which helps the body adapt and reduces the intensity of side effects.
- Eat Smaller, More Frequent Meals: This can prevent the stomach from feeling overly full and reduce nausea.
- Choose Bland Foods: Opt for foods that are easy to digest, like toast, crackers, or rice, especially during the initial weeks.
-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water throughout the day. This is vital, especially if experiencing diarrhea or vomiting, to prevent dehydration.
- Avoid Fatty or Spicy Foods: These can exacerbate gastrointestinal discomfort.
- Over-the-Counter Remedies: Antacids for heartburn or anti-diarrhea medications, under medical guidance, can provide relief.
Injection Site Reactions
Some individuals may experience mild reactions at the injection site, such as redness, itching, or slight swelling. These are usually temporary and can be managed by rotating injection sites each week and ensuring proper injection technique, which your healthcare provider will teach you.

Identifying and Addressing Serious Risks Associated with Tirzepatide
While tirzepatide is generally well-tolerated, it is crucial to be aware of the more serious, albeit rarer, potential risks. Understanding these helps answer “is it safe to take tirzepatide?” thoroughly and underscores the necessity of continuous medical monitoring. Our commitment to your safety means transparency about these possibilities.
Thyroid Concerns
One of the most notable warnings associated with tirzepatide is the potential for thyroid C-cell tumors, including medullary thyroid carcinoma (MTC), observed in rodent studies. It is currently unknown whether tirzepatide causes these tumors or MTC in humans. However, due to this finding, tirzepatide should not be used in individuals with a personal or family history of MTC or in those with Multiple Endocrine Neoplasia syndrome type 2 (MEN 2), a genetic condition that increases the risk of certain endocrine cancers, including MTC.
Symptoms to watch for: If you develop a lump or swelling in your neck or throat, trouble swallowing or breathing, or if your voice becomes persistently hoarse, you must contact your healthcare provider immediately.
Pancreatitis (Inflammation of the Pancreas)
Pancreatitis is a serious condition that has been reported in individuals taking GLP-1 receptor agonists, including tirzepatide.
Symptoms to watch for: Seek immediate medical attention if you experience sudden and severe stomach pain that does not go away, with or without vomiting. This pain may radiate from your abdomen to your back.
Gallbladder Problems
Gallbladder issues, such as gallstones (cholelithiasis) or inflammation of the gallbladder (cholecystitis), can occur with rapid weight loss, and have been reported with tirzepatide use.
Symptoms to watch for: Consult your doctor right away if you experience severe stomach pain, particularly in the upper abdomen, accompanied by nausea, vomiting, fever, or yellowing of the skin or eyes (jaundice).
Kidney Injury
Severe gastrointestinal side effects like vomiting and diarrhea can lead to dehydration, which, in turn, can cause or worsen kidney problems, including acute kidney injury. Maintaining adequate hydration is vital.
Symptoms to watch for: Decreased urine output, swelling of your ankles, feet, or hands, muscle twitching, nausea, rapid weight gain, or unusual tiredness or weakness. Contact your healthcare provider immediately if these symptoms appear.
Hypoglycemia (Low Blood Sugar)
Tirzepatide does not typically cause low blood sugar on its own. However, the risk of hypoglycemia significantly increases when tirzepatide is used in combination with other diabetes medications that can lower blood sugar, such as insulin or sulfonylureas. Low blood sugar can also occur if you delay or miss meals, exercise more than usual, or consume alcohol.
Symptoms to watch for: Dizziness, lightheadedness, sweating, confusion, drowsiness, headache, blurred vision, slurred speech, shakiness, fast heartbeat, anxiety, irritability, or extreme hunger. If these symptoms occur, it’s essential to consume a source of quick sugar immediately. Always carry glucose tablets or gel, fruit juice, or non-diet soft drinks. For severe symptoms, a glucagon kit may be necessary, and you and your family should know how to use it.
Serious Allergic Reactions
Life-threatening allergic reactions (anaphylaxis and angioedema) are rare but possible.
Symptoms to watch for: Get medical help immediately if you experience swelling of your face, lips, tongue, or throat, trouble breathing or swallowing, a severe rash or itching, fainting or feeling dizzy, or a very rapid heartbeat.
Changes in Vision
Some individuals with type 2 diabetes have reported changes in vision, including worsening of diabetic retinopathy, during treatment with GLP-1 receptor agonists. Regular eye exams are recommended for individuals with diabetes.
Symptoms to watch for: Blurred vision or any other changes in vision should be reported to your doctor.
Mental Health Considerations
There have been reports of mood changes, including agitation, irritability, or unusual behaviors, and in rare instances, suicidal thoughts or tendencies, or increased depression, with GLP-1 receptor agonists.
Symptoms to watch for: Pay close attention to any changes in your mood, behaviors, feelings, or thoughts. Contact your healthcare provider right away if you notice any new, worsening, or concerning mental changes.

Crucial Considerations and Drug Interactions with Tirzepatide
Beyond specific side effects, several critical considerations and potential drug interactions are vital for anyone asking, “is it safe to take tirzepatide?” These factors require careful discussion with your healthcare provider to ensure the medication is integrated safely into your overall health regimen.
Pregnancy and Breastfeeding
One of the most important considerations involves pregnancy and breastfeeding. Using tirzepatide while pregnant can potentially harm an unborn baby. For individuals who could become pregnant, it is strongly advised to discontinue tirzepatide for at least two months before planning a pregnancy. Weight loss is generally not recommended during pregnancy, and maintaining healthy blood sugar levels, if applicable, can help reduce the risk of pregnancy complications.
If you become pregnant while taking tirzepatide, or are planning to, it is imperative to inform your doctor immediately to discuss the best course of action. For those who are breastfeeding, the safety of tirzepatide has not been extensively studied, and it is unknown whether the medication passes into breast milk. We recommend discussing the best way to feed your baby with your healthcare provider while using tirzepatide. Our compassionate care recognizes the unique circumstances of every individual, and our team is here to support you in making informed decisions.
Contraception
Due to tirzepatide’s effect on gastric emptying, it can potentially reduce the effectiveness of oral birth control pills. Healthcare providers may recommend using a non-oral contraceptive method or adding a barrier method of contraception for at least four weeks after starting tirzepatide and for four weeks after each dose increase. This ensures consistent protection and minimizes unintended pregnancies. Your care team can help you find the contraceptive option that works best for you.
Alcohol Consumption
Drinking alcohol while taking tirzepatide, especially for individuals managing type 2 diabetes, can significantly increase the risk of severe low blood sugar (hypoglycemia). It’s crucial to discuss your alcohol consumption habits with your healthcare provider, as they may recommend limiting or avoiding alcohol during your treatment.
Interactions with Other Medications, Supplements, and Procedures
Tirzepatide can interact with various other substances, influencing its safety and effectiveness. It is vital to provide your healthcare provider with a complete list of all medications you are currently taking, including:
- Prescription medications: This includes other diabetes medications (e.g., insulin, sulfonylureas, which increase hypoglycemia risk), certain blood pressure medications, heart disease medications, and warfarin.
- Over-the-counter (OTC) drugs: Such as aspirin, NSAIDs (ibuprofen, naproxen), and medications for allergies, colds, or coughs.
- Herbal and vitamin supplements: Some supplements can also interact with tirzepatide.
- Weight loss medications: Avoid taking other medications specifically for appetite control or weight loss unless explicitly discussed and approved by your doctor.
Surgical Procedures
If you are scheduled for surgery or any medical procedure, inform your care team that you are taking tirzepatide. Your medication may need to be temporarily stopped or adjusted to prevent complications.
Hydration
Staying adequately hydrated is paramount. Drink water often and incorporate fruits and vegetables with high water content into your diet. Dehydration can exacerbate certain side effects and potentially lead to kidney issues, especially in situations involving fever, infection, vomiting, or diarrhea.
Medical Identification
If you have diabetes and are taking tirzepatide, wearing a medical ID bracelet or neck chain and carrying an ID card that lists your condition and medications is a wise safety measure for emergencies.

The Distinction: Approved vs. Compounded Tirzepatide
When evaluating “is it safe to take tirzepatide,” a critical aspect to understand is the difference between FDA-approved branded versions and compounded versions of the medication. This distinction carries significant implications for safety, quality, and efficacy.
FDA-Approved Branded Medications
The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) rigorously reviews medications before they can be marketed and sold. This review process ensures that a drug is safe and effective for its intended use and manufactured under strict quality standards.
- Mounjaro®: This is the FDA-approved brand name for tirzepatide indicated for the treatment of type 2 diabetes mellitus, alongside diet and exercise.
- Zepbound®: This is the FDA-approved brand name for tirzepatide specifically indicated for chronic weight management in adults with obesity or overweight with at least one weight-related comorbid condition.
These FDA-approved products have undergone extensive clinical trials and meet the highest standards for quality, consistency, and patient safety.
Understanding Compounded Medications
Compounded drugs are custom-prepared by licensed pharmacists for individual patients based on a prescription from a licensed healthcare provider. A compounded drug might be appropriate if a patient’s medical need cannot be met by an FDA-approved drug (e.g., an allergy to an ingredient in the approved version) or if the FDA-approved drug is not commercially available.
However, it is crucial to understand a key difference: compounded drugs are not FDA approved. This means the FDA does not review compounded drugs for safety, effectiveness, or quality before they are marketed.
Concerns with Compounded Tirzepatide:
The FDA has identified several areas of concern regarding compounded GLP-1 receptor agonists, including tirzepatide:
- Lack of FDA Review: Without FDA approval, compounded products do not undergo the same rigorous evaluation for purity, potency, and consistency as branded drugs.
- Quality and Safety Risks: The active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s) used in compounding might originate from sources that do not meet FDA’s stringent manufacturing standards. The FDA has established import alerts to help stop GLP-1 APIs with potential quality concerns from entering the U.S. supply chain.
- Fraudulent Products: The FDA is aware of fraudulent compounded semaglutide and tirzepatide marketed with false information on labels, sometimes even listing non-existent pharmacies or pharmacies that did not actually compound the product. Patients are encouraged to be vigilant and verify the source of their medicine.
- Dosing Errors: There have been reports of adverse events, some requiring hospitalization, due to dosing errors with compounded injectable products. This can result from patients measuring incorrect doses or healthcare professionals miscalculating. Prescribing doses beyond what is in the FDA-approved drug label (e.g., higher doses, more frequent administration, or rapid titration) has also led to serious adverse events.
- Unapproved Salt Forms: Some compounded products may use salt forms of tirzepatide, such as tirzepatide sodium or tirzepatide acetate. These are different active ingredients from what is used in the approved drugs, and the FDA has not confirmed if they have the same chemical and pharmacologic properties or if there’s a lawful basis for their use in compounding.
